ABOUT MS

Multiple Sclerosis is a chronic, unpredictable autoimmune disease of the central nervous system (CNS) in which the immune system incorrectly attacks healthy tissue. Surrounding and protecting the nerve fibers of the CNS is a fatty tissue called myelin, which helps nerve fibers conduct electrical impulses. In MS, myelin is lost in multiple areas, leaving scar tissue called sclerosis. When myelin or the nerve fiber is destroyed or damaged, the ability of the nerves to conduct electrical impulses to and from the brain is disrupted, and this produces the various symptoms of MS.

More than 2.3 million people are affected by MS worldwide ….(and) someone gets newly diagnosed with this disease every hour of every day.

The total lifetime cost for individual MS healthcare is $1.2 million.

ABOUT THE MS FITNESS CHALLENGE

David Lyons was hospitalized and diagnosed with Multiple Sclerosis at the age of 47. A former bodybuilder and health club owner, he exercised regularly and lived a healthy lifestyle. He was devastated by the diagnosis and frustrated by the physical limitations of his condition. While in the hospital the doctors told David he would most likely leave in a wheelchair and would not return to his normal workout routine. They also warned him that MS is a disease that most often progressively worsens and to prepare for his limitations as he ages. So what does David do? At the age of 50 he decided to compete in a bodybuilding competition!

David knew he could not do this alone, so he assembled a team he calls The Challenge Team. David’s doctors all told him that his pursuit of a bodybuilding title was sheer madness, especially at 50 years old...but if anyone could do it - he could. On August 22, 2009, David competed in his first competition where he was awarded The Most Inspirational Bodybuilder trophy!

The MS Fitness Challenge was birthed from founder David Lyons’ MS Bodybuilding Challenge and his wife, registered nurse, Kendra’s desire to help others who suffer from Multiple Sclerosis. His personal challenge and his book, David’s Goliath, about his journey as a bodybuilder with MS, are inspirations to others who find the obstacles in life too difficult to overcome. WHAT WE DO

It is the mission of the MS Fitness Challenge to provide certified fitness professionals to people with MS nationwide in an effort to educate and train them in the benefits of exercise and nutrition in winning the battle against Multiple Sclerosis. MSFC pays for these professionals to work with the person signed up for a 12 week “Challenge” program and a membership for that person at a host fitness center through the donations of its supporters.

We kick off each 12 week fitness challenge at our MSFC events. Our large free fundraising events are open to the public and include live music, fitness demonstrations, giveaways, raffles, and more, with all funds raised also going directly towards the cost of providing a personal trainer, gym membership, nutritional supplements, and ongoing support for each participant with MS during the 12 week Fitness Challenge program.
